Russian Bride skips out after getting green card

Short story: I brought my Russian fiancee to America in February of 2009 and married her same month. September 2009 she got her temp. green card and I sent her to Russia for a 5 week family visit. She returned to Atlanta on October 22, 2009 and instead of changing planes to a flight to Montana, she called me from Atlanta and said she needs a week to think and would call me in a week. That was the last time I spoke to her. I filed a report of marriage fraud with two agents from ICE the first of November 2009. I then heard nothing from them until March 2010. On March 2, 2010 I wrote to the secretary of DHS, Janet Napolitano and Senator Max Baccus asking for information. I received answers from both (DHS in 6 weeks and Senator Baccus some time later). Both letters stated that whatever the US government knows about my wife is between my wife and the government. Basically it is none of my business. I know where my wife is because she has posted a profile on Facebook. She describes her relationship status as complicated and her interest as men. I contacted ICE again and was told that there is nothing that I or they can do until her 2 year anniversary comes up for review. Meantime she is tanning herself on the beach in NC and trolling for men. Need a suggestion on how to get ICE to actually enforce the immigration laws and deport my wife back to Russia.
